Scheme
Use this section to select the Colors and Fonts scheme. IntelliJ IDEA suggests several pre-defined schemes, one of them being the default.
- The selected scheme applies to the editor only!
- Refer to the section Configuring Colors and Fonts for details.
| Item | Description |
|---|---|
| Scheme name | From this drop-down list, select the Colors & Fonts scheme to use in your workspace. Note that you can edit a default color scheme, same as a custom scheme. |
| Save As | Click this button to save the currently selected Colors & Fonts settings as a new scheme. |
| Delete | Click this button to delete the current scheme. Note that the default color schemes cannot be deleted! |
| Reset | Click this button to reset color scheme to initial defaults shipped with IntelliJ IDEA. |
| Import | Click this button to import the desired color scheme from an external file (supported formats depend on the installed IDE extensions). . |
Scheme settings
Use the corresponding pages to change font type, colors and highlighting for the supported languages, consoles, debugger, version control, differences viewer, file statuses, and scopes. Note that besides color settings, highlighting is determined by your Inspection Profile. For example, if you do not want unused symbols to be highlighted, turn off the Unused Symbol inspection in the profile being used.
Choose specific nested page, and configure as required.
